Kathy, this beautiful rose photograph shows that not only bees and butterflies love nectar, but ants too. If ants crawl into a rose, it is usually a sign that the leaves of the rose don't (yet) have aphids. In that case, the ants would have regarded the aphids as their dairy cows. The aphids secrete a sweet liquid that seems to be even more attractive to the ants than the rose nectar.
